While Penkridge train station might not boast grandiose lounges or bustling shopping centers, it provides all the essential services to kick-start your travel smoothly. It is important to note that there isn’t a manned ticket office, but convenient ticket machines are available for you to collect your purchases made online. Although smartcard facilities are not available, you’ll be pleased to find an induction loop installed for those who require it.
For those interested in accessibility, Penkridge station is rated as step-free access category A, ensuring easy access for all passengers. Make sure to use the assistance meeting points and catch the station’s Conductor's attention for additional help. Customer help points are strategically placed for support, while CCTVs keep the surroundings secure. However, amenities such as waiting lounges, refreshment facilities, and public Wi-Fi are lacking, encouraging passengers to plan accordingly.
Navigating transportation options from Penkridge station is straightforward. For onward journeys, multiple links with local bus services and taxis are available at strategic points. Rail replacement services operate from the bus stop on A449 near St Michaels Square to Stafford, and from A449 and Crown Bridge junction for Wolverhampton-bound travelers. Stone (Staffs) station operates efficiently with essential amenities, albeit without the traditional ticket office. Passengers can easily collect pre-purchased tickets via the available machines, although they are not wheelchair accessible. For those needing assistance or additional information, help points are installed, complemented by live departure screens and announcements. However, there is no dedicated staff to offer help at the station.
Accessibility is a priority with some step-free access available, classified as category B3. Travelers who need assistance should coordinate with the conductor on the platform. While you're there, note that the station lacks waiting rooms, first-class lounges, and refreshment facilities, so it's best to prepare accordingly before arrival.
For journeys beyond Stone, the station offers practical connections. Rail replacement services operate from nearby Granville Square towards Stafford, and from Crown Street to Stoke-on-Trent.
